#@@# 16 Gauge Top#@#
The 16 gauge Type 304 stainless steel top offers durable resistance to dents and stains, supporting frequent cutting, rolling, and hot pan placement without rapid wear. Designers included a rounded bullnose edge that reduces injury risk and prevents edge damage during rigorous daily use.
#@@# 5 Inch Backsplash#@#
A full-length 5 inch backsplash prevents liquids and debris from reaching walls, protecting finishes and simplifying sanitation protocols. Maintenance crews benefit from fewer deep-clean cycles because splash containment limits residue buildup behind the table.
#@@# Open Base Storage#@#
The open base with side and rear crossrails provides unobstructed access to stored equipment and supplies, enabling faster line replenishment and clearer sight lines for staff. Crossrails increase lateral rigidity so the table sustains uniform load distribution across the top.
#@@# Adjustable Feet#@#
Adjustable stainless steel bullet feet allow precise leveling on uneven floors, ensuring stable work surfaces and reducing wobble during high-volume tasks. Field technicians can set height quickly to integrate with surrounding equipment and ergonomic workflows.
